Si estas intentando usar git con github e intentando loguearte debes saber que ya no es posible desde el 13 de agosto de 2021, pero te traigo el paso a paso actualizado a 2021, para que puedas conectarlo, son unos simples pasos más nada más totalmente ilustado.
Paso 1: generar token de acceso personal en Github
1.1- Inicia sesión en tu cuenta de GitHub
1.2- En la esquina superior derecha, haga clic en el logotipo del perfil de usuario .
1.3- Seleccionar configuración
1.4- Vamos a opciones de desarrollador (Developer settings)
1.5- Clic en Personal access tokens. Y seleccionar Generate new token.
1.6- Dale a tu token un nombre descriptivo en el campo Note
Selecciona el tiempo de vencimiento.
- Repo
- admin:org
- admin:gpg_key
Y clic en Generate token (botón verde inferior)
Nos va a dar el token el cual debemos copiar.
Paso 2: usar el token de acceso personal para la autenticación
Para sistemas operativos basados en Linux
2.1- Deberás configurar un usuario para iniciar sesión y una dirección de correo electrónico en el cliente GIT local para Linux. En la terminal. Con -l listaras los datos cargados.
git config --global user.name "your_github_username" git config --global user.email "your_github_email" git config -l
2.2- Después de configurar GIT, hacemos un clonado del repositorio, y nos pide el usuario y en vez de usar la clave usaremos el token.
Si no tenes nada porque es nuevo el repositorio te va a decir que no hay nada por hacer. Pero podes hacer un pull más abajo con -v.
git clone https://github.com/YOUR-USERNAME/YOUR-REPOSITORY
2.3- Ahora podes almacenar en caché el registro proporcionado en tu equipo para almacenar el token.
git config --global credential.helper cache
2.4- Para verificar, intenta tirar con -v.
git pull -v
2.5- Podes eliminar el registro de la caché si es necesario.
git config --global --unset credential.helper
git config --system --unset credential.helper
Con eso sería suficiente para volver a conectar con nuestro repositorio en github.










